Ultimate Classic Rock
http://ultimateclassicrock.com/fleetwood-mac-2013-tour/

After months of increasing speculation, Fleetwood Mac have confirmed the dates, cities and venues for a nine-week tour beginning in April of 2013.

According to Rolling Stone, the 34 announced dates of the trek, their first since 2009, will kick off April 4 in Columbus, Ohio and wind up June 12 in Detroit, MI. There’s no indication of Christine McVie, who retired in 1998, rejoining her former bandmates so it’s assumed the rest of the ‘Rumours’-era lineup (Stevie Nicks, Lindsey Buckingham, John McVie and Mick Fleetwood) will appear.

Nicks insists the band has chosen the perfect time to hit the road, declaring that “2013 is going to be the year of Fleetwood Mac.’ She also reveals that the band cut two new songs a couple of weeks ago that might make it onto the show’s setlists.

The group begins rehearsals on Feb. 15, and promises to take this tour all over the world, with both festival and regular concerts in Europe and a 15-city Australian visit penciled in for after the North American dates.

Fleetwood Mac: Tour and Glasto Rumors
Band to tour US and talk about European festival shows
Filed in Fleetwood Mac, News at 16.03pm on 04 December 12

Stevie Nicks has sparked rumours that Fleetwood Mac could headline Glastonbury next year.

The band announced a series of US shows today, although no European dates have been confirmed so far.

Discussing the prospect of playing European shows, meanwhile, Nicks said: "If everything goes will we'll be in Europe doing festivals this summer. Then we'll actually tour Europe, which is different than just doing festivals. Then we might do 15 or so shows in Australia."
